CARAMELIZED SWEET POTATOES   
  Ingredients :
    3 lb 5 oz (1 ½ k) small yellow sweet potatoes, unpeeled
    ½ cup white sugar
    ½ cup brown sugar
    ½ cup water
    4 tablespoons unsalted butter
    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
    Salt

  Preparation:

Melt butter in a saucepan (do not boil), add white sugar and cinnamon and combine. Add brown sugar and water and bring to a boil over high heat until it has the texture of a syrup. Set aside.
Arrange sweet potatoes in one layer on the bottom of a heavy large saucepan or skillet with a lid.
Sprinkle 2 or 3 tablespoons water over sweet potatoes and cover saucepan. Cook at very low heat for approximately 1 hour or until tender. Shake saucepan several times during cooking to avoid burning sweet potatoes. Remove sweet potatoes from the saucepan as soon as they are soft and tender. Peel while they are still warm and cut into 1 inch (2 ½ cm) thick slices.
Place the sweet potato slices in a slightly buttered ovenproof serving dish and pour reserved syrup over them. Bake in preheated oven to 350°F (180°C) for 30 minutes more.
Serve with meats, turkey, ham.
